"Rare Beautiful Officer's Office Armchair "maison Jansen", In Beech Cane Back Leather Seat"
Atypical and rare office armchair, model taken over by Maison Jansen in the '70s and looks great with its seat in thick, wide and deep and comfortable wafer in green leather like the armrests in suspended strap embellished at the top of the backrest as well as at the upright before beautiful ornaments in pretty patinated bronzes and decorated with forks for steel assembly. Pure Officer's bivouac seat style which was originally folding for ease of transport (arched legs) for stability and resistance. It has settled down for our greatest satisfaction, with a honey tone, robust in a beautiful solid wood carved in the bamboo style, the legs and the opulent and non-foldable structure imitate... Its big brother from the war campaigns, very stable and robust it is a beautiful and comfortable office chair the caned backrest in good condition ensures support for the back, as for the soft and thick pad the comfort of the seat for long periods of work; Decorative as possible and useful, solid and unusual, Maison Jansen that I knew on rue Royale in Paris only sold to a small number of privileged customers. It no longer exists in the current state of things but can boast to have brought into fashion elegant furniture with careful finishing, sculpture like line and good condition and ready to return to service...
